  1. It is supposed to be unlucky to throw out ashes on a Monday morning. If anyone does that, he will have bad luck for the rest of the week.
    The custom of the morning on the first of May is to put May bushes in front of the door. Some time during that day, put a branch of the rowan tree around the churn, and also over the byre door. It is supposed to supposed to keep witches from taking the butter.
